Abstract
For the purpose of quantitative inversion in coastal waters by using the CCD data of Satellite HJ-1A,the precision of radiance calibration coefficients of the CCD mounted on Satellite HJ-1A was validated and a cross radiance calibration was performed based on the data from Landsat-5 TM.And then,an inversion was made of the reflectivity of coastal waters on the basis of all these data.By comparing the results from the inversion and those from the measurements,it has been found that the cross radiance calibration for the CCT data of Satellite HJ-1A can,to a certain extent,improve the precision of the inversion of the reflectivity of coastal waters.These results indicate that the onboard radiance calibration coefficients of the CCD images on Satellite HJ-1A are not precise so enough that the cross radiance calibration should be also applied when the CCD data from Satellite HJ-1A are used to carry out the quantitative inversion in the coastal waters.
